Autoren-Porträt von Maureen Callahan
Maureen Callahan has worked as an editor and writer at the New York Post, covering everything from the subcultures of the Lower East Side to local and national politics. She has also written for Spin, New York, Vanity Fair, and Sassy. She lives in New York City.
